The Learning and Development Solutions team is focused on supporting a culture at Quest where all colleagues can develop grow and be successful in their current roles as well as build meaningful careers.The team fosters high quality learning and development experiences by setting and enforcing standards for quality learning solutions managing EMPower Learn as our primary platform for learning providing engaging learning content through EMPower and supporting our community of learning professionals in their efforts to create and manage effective learning experiences.

The Sr. Manager Learning and Development Solutions will lead a team of L&D specialists and play a key leadership role in setting and driving the strategic direction for learning and development at Quest promoting a skills-driven learning culture that best supports employee development. This role will lead the programmatic and technology approaches to cultural transformation including enhancements to the learner experience; alignment of needed skills with current and future roles; best practices for live virtual and online learning; advancing methods for learning in the flow of work; managing content availability; and learning management system enhancements. The incumbent will also provide leadership and subject matter expertise for complex large and enterprise-wide projects such as new technology or system implementations leveraging the application of analysis design development implementation and evaluation (ADDIE) principles. The Sr. Manager will also have responsibility to manage and advance strategic workforce development projects that focus on enhancing employee skills.

The position is hybrid (3 days per week in office) will be based at Quest Diagnostics HQ in Secaucus NJ.



Responsibilities
  • Develops and executes strategic plan to promote a skills-focused culture of learning aligned with business goals and workforce development needs.

  • Manages guides and inspires the Learning & Development Solutions team to deliver high quality customer-focused services for the day-to-day team operations including content creation and curation learning solution consultations facilitation of the Learning Community of Practice creation of user guides and job aids management of enterprise training assignments reporting and use of dashboard tools implementation of LMS upgrades addressing escalated service requests from the HR Service Center and LMS tool optimization/planning.

  • Researches and implements new approaches for engaging learners including the use of technology emphasizing application and practice in the flow of work.

  • Builds organizational capability to design and deliver high quality learning solutions including management of the L&D playbook governance the effective use of instructional design/authoring tools and delivery and the introduction of innovative approaches to learning.

  • Provides strategic direction for special development projects and programs and leads learning/training approaches for larger enterprise initiatives.

  • Develops and executes plan to better connect learner skill needs with LMS course content creating a library of skills and competencies connected to job roles and levels.

  • Develops maintains and actions on ongoing L&D evaluation metrics including learning satisfaction acquisition application and impact.

  • Partners closely with:

    • HRIT on the strategic approaches feature deployment and roadmap for the LMS;

    • HR Service Center on day-to-day support tools reference guides and escalations to the Learning and Development Solutions team;

    • HRBPs to assess client group development needs and deploy learning solutions critical for job and career growth;

    • Organizational Effectiveness and Belonging COE colleagues on development approaches to support leadership development performance career growth succession planning change management engagement and culture & belonging;

    • L&D leaders aligned to internal functional groups to recommend development approaches consistent with the L&D playbook standards governance approaches and best practice; and

    • External providers (instructional design content partners etc.) to provide high quality content consultation tools materials etc. while ensuring accountability for deliverables.

  • Aligns employee development needs with talent management initiatives (e.g. leadership and other competency models career paths etc.) in partnership with the Talent Management team and other key stakeholders

  • On occasion: facilitates instructor led workshops for specific skill-building initiatives; designs EMPower modules for high-profile enterprise-wide initiatives.

  • Actively engages as a team member of the Organizational Effectiveness and Belonging Center of Excellence advancing programs and strategies to promote a healthy engaged and productive workforce ready to meet Quests business goals



Qualifications
  • Minimum 5-7 years demonstrated experience designing and developing adult training with emphasis on career development
  • Advanced instructional design and development skills with a demonstrated mastery of adult learning principles. Proven expertise in high-level leadership/management/soft-skills ILT and eLearning design and development.
  • Strong orientation towards the ADDIE model with the ability to execute accordingly.
  • Experience designing and implementing effective learning and development solutions and programs for an enterprise with large scale initiatives executed across multiple business and functional units ideally within a healthcare service environment
  • Experience understanding and application of processes and products in enterprise-level learning and development programs
  • Understands and uses technology enabled solutions to increase speed and effectiveness of learning and development solutions.
  • Familiarity with project management approaches tools and phases of the project lifecycle
  • Familiarity with instructional design/video editing tools such as Articulate Rise 360
  • Demonstrated ability to use business process excellence tools to continually improve programs based on changing environment business requirements stakeholder requirements and feedback mechanisms.

Education

Bachelors Degree in adult education instructional design organizational behavior industrial/organizational psychology HR management or related field
Masters Degree (MBA Masters in Organizational Development Adult Education or related field) preferred
